BIOGRAPHY

Jacques Villeret, born Jacky Boufroura in 1951, is a beloved figure in French cinema, celebrated for his unforgettable performances, particularly as François Pignon in the iconic comedy *Le Dîner de Cons* (1998). This role not only catapulted him to international fame but also made the film a must-have for collectors, as its humor and cultural significance resonate through the years. Villeret's portrayal of the endearing yet hapless character is a highlight of his career, showcasing his remarkable ability to blend comedy with deep emotional resonance. Beyond *Le Dîner de Cons*, Villeret's filmography includes notable titles such as *La soupe aux choux* (1981) and *Papy fait de la résistance* (1983), both of which have garnered cult status among enthusiasts of classic French cinema. His later works, including *Iznogoud* (2005) and *Le Furet* (2003), further illustrate his versatility and dedication to his craft. What genres did Jacques Villeret frequently work in during his career?

Jacques Villeret appeared in a variety of genres including comedy, drama, romance, crime, war, and history films.

In which decade was Jacques Villeret most active as an actor?

Jacques Villeret was most active during the 1980s, with many notable roles throughout that decade.

What is one of Jacques Villeret's notable roles in a comedy film?

He played Haroun El Poussah in the 2005 comedy film Iznogoud.

Can you name a historical film featuring Jacques Villeret and his role in it?

In the 1983 historical drama Danton, Jacques Villeret portrayed François-Joseph Westermann.
